With NFL teams looking to maximize the potential and versatility of their rosters, the Detroit Lions got a head start on moving some pieces around before the August 27 cut day deadline by waiving offensive lineman Keaton Sutherland from injured reserve.
The Detroit Lions announced they released OL Keaton Sutherland from injured reserve with an injury settlement on Friday. Sutherland, 28, was signed by the Bengals as an undrafted free agent out of Texas A&M following the 2019 NFL Draft.
